Output 25d58deebf3e91d1c6146f58282116e75fc98d295a21ef926ad6ada705bcbf3e:61

value
211888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776f569935dd0f18a20b24fd97866584b5f5aa45 OP_EQUAL
address
3CaXiHohjgcQNQt7FBnC2j47Dni7aqF4GC
transaction
25d58deebf3e91d1c6146f58282116e75fc98d295a21ef926ad6ada705bcbf3e
confirmations
416648
spent
true